Things to do in Syracuse?Syracuse, New York is a vibrant city located in Onondaga County. This welcoming community offers plenty for visitors to explore such as the stunning Everson Museum of Art or one of many popular restaurants. Residents here also take advantage of all the outdoor activities available at Onondaga Lake Park and NBT Bank Stadium. With its excellent school system, thriving businesses, and numerous recreational opportunities it's no wonder why so many people choose to make Syracuse their home.
